## Gateway Rate Limiting — Reviewer Notes

The Lattixo gateway enforces per-client token buckets configured in `limits.yaml`. When reviewing changes, confirm that new routes declare an explicit tier rather than inheriting the default, and that burst values stay below the upstream capacity documented in the Harkwell runbook. Limit overrides require sign-off from the platform group. Deployments of updated limit configs must be signed before the gateway will accept them, using the key below.

signing key of kahog-kadup = bky13_6wLyxnPsJob4P

Subject: Handover — Shrinkray CLI ops

Welcome aboard. Shrinkray is our batch image-resizing CLI; it queues jobs, writes progress rows, and stores output manifests per run. Cron kicks it off hourly. If jobs stall, check the manifests table for stuck rows before restarting. Docs live in the team wiki under Tooling. The jobs database it writes to is reachable via the string below.

primary connection of yagep-kahip = redis://giliel_svc:zYiKsLL2PLpfPL@db-348f.xolmarsys.corp:5432/fenwyn

# Runbook: Hunting leaked file descriptors in Quillgate

When the `fd_open` gauge climbs steadily between deploys, suspect a leak rather than load. First confirm on a single pod: exec in and count entries under `/proc/1/fd`, noting how many are sockets in CLOSE_WAIT versus regular files. Capture two snapshots ten minutes apart before restarting anything — we need the delta for the postmortem. Reproduce locally with the Marbury load harness, which requires the service running with the following configuration values.

settings of yagep-bajog:
[istdor]
port = 4000
region = south-2
host = istdor.qorvelcorp.internal
timeout_ms = 5000
retries = 5

**Mgmt Meeting Minutes — Retiring the Brightline Range**

Quick recap for sales leads at Fenholt Supplies: we agreed to retire the Brightline fixture range by year-end. Remaining stock moves to clearance pricing next month, and accounts on standing orders get migrated to the Lumetta range. Trade-in incentives were approved in principle. The confidential note on next steps sits just below.

board note of bajof-bajeg: The pricing group signed off on a budget of $13.4 million for Project Sildor. The renewal with Lamixek Holdings closes at $48.9 million a year, 49 percent above the last contract.